Share
Key job responsibilities
As a System Development Engineer, you will/may:Create or have responsibility to improve or intent small tools or applications.
Diverse Experiences
AWS values diverse experiences. Even if you do not meet all of the preferred qualifications and skills listed in the job description, we encourage candidates to apply. If your career is just starting, hasn’t followed a traditional path, or includes alternative experiences, don’t let it stop you from applying.
Mentorship & Career Growth
We’re continuously raising our performance bar as we strive to become Earth’s Best Employer. That’s why you’ll find endless knowledge-sharing, mentorship and other career-advancing resources here to help you develop into a better-rounded professional.Work/Life Balance
Knowledge of systems engineering fundamentals (networking, storage, operating systems)
Experience (non-internship) in professional software development
Experience designing or architecting (design patterns, reliability and scaling) of new and existing systems
Experience in networking, storage systems, operating systems and hands-on systems engineering
Experience programming with at least one modern language such as C++, C#, Java, Python, Golang, PowerShell, Ruby
Experience with PowerShell (preferred), Python, Ruby, or Java
Experience working in an Agile environment using the Scrum methodology
These jobs might be a good fit